How Storage Affects Cannabis Products

Cannabis products may change when exposed to excessive heat, direct light, moisture, air, or frequent temperature changes. Different product types react differently, which is why flower, gummies, concentrates, and pre-rolls should not always be stored in exactly the same way.

Live Rosin Appearance

Live rosin can have different textures, including badder, batter, jam, sauce-like consistency, cold cure, or more stable forms depending on processing and storage. Different textures can be normal and do not automatically establish that one rosin product is superior.

Checking Testing Transparency

Laboratory testing is a significant consideration when evaluating regulated cannabis products, including infused pre-rolls. A certificate of analysis, or COA, is a laboratory document linked to a particular product batch.
